Table 5.
Maximum difference between the solution for the extracellular potential in Ωe\Γ computed by the EMI method and each of the other methods for the test cases in Figure 9.
Method | Maximum difference (mV) | Relative maximum difference (%) |
---|---|---|
(A) Neurons separated by 10 μm | ||
CBV | 0.025 | 12.6 |
CP | 0.087 | 43.2 |
CS | 0.086 | 42.4 |
(B) Neurons separated by 4 μm | ||
CBV | 0.014 | 5.2 |
CP | 0.141 | 52.9 |
CS | 0.128 | 48.3 |
The relative maximum differences are computed as the maximum difference divided by the maximum absolute value of the extracellular potential computed by the EMI method. The abbreviations (EMI, CBV, CP, and CS) are summarized in Table 1.
